一、JIRA简介
Jira是一个项目管理平台,由澳大利亚Atlassian公司开发的一款优秀的软件问题跟踪管理工具;支持多语言、干净和强大的用户界面;可以在几乎所有硬件、操作系统和数据库平台运行;配置灵活,功能强大,在全球范围被广泛使用。
主要用户群:项目经理、TeamLeader、开发人员、测试人员。
主要功能:项目管理、问题管理、缺陷管理、工作流。
核心竞争力:
(1)支持配置多种插件
(2)可整合多种开发工具
(3)自定义多类型工作流
(4)支持云端和本地搭建
用户手册:https://www.atlassian.com/zh/software/jira/guides
JIRA VS 禅道
角度 | JIRA | 禅道 |
是否收费 | 是 | 否(开源版) |
产品侧重点 | Issue驱动项目管理 | 集中式(需求,任务,bug) |
可扩展性 | 强(自定义工作流,API) | 开源可扩展 |
易用性 | 新手不友好 | 新手友好 |
国内市场覆盖率 | 广 | 窄 |
二、基本使用流程
1.创建问题 2.选择问题类型 3.填写问题内容 4.分配问题 5.根据工作流解决问题(关键点,每家公司情况不一样)
三、测试管理流程
测试用例集(测试套件)、测试用例
测试计划、测试周期(执行)
发现问题-提交BUG
修复-指派
回测
完成、测试报告
四、JIRA的使用者
企业管理层:关注软件的开发节点、人员的问题(bug数量,解决问题)
项目经理:项目进度、项目质量(缺陷的数量、缺陷的严重程度)
测试人员:提交缺陷、回归关闭缺陷
开发人员:看问题、确认和解决的缺陷
其他人员:需求人员、设计人员、运维人员 在使用软件的过程中做一些提交问题,或解答问题。
五、JIRA中的问题(Issue)概念
把问题解决了即相当于把一个事情做完了。
六、JIRA中的工作流
工作的开展、流转(所有的问题都是一个工作),一个问题的流动。